os.environ["PATH"] = ":".join(olds)
-def finalize_default_tools(args: Args, config: Config, *, resources: Path) -> Config:
+def finalize_default_tools(config: Config, *, resources: Path) -> Config:
if not config.tools_tree_distribution:
die(
f"{config.distribution} does not have a default tools tree distribution",
*(["--proxy-peer-certificate", str(p)] if (p := config.proxy_peer_certificate) else []),
*(["--proxy-client-certificate", str(p)] if (p := config.proxy_client_certificate) else []),
*(["--proxy-client-key", str(p)] if (p := config.proxy_client_key) else []),
- *(["-f"] * args.force),
] # fmt: skip
_, [tools] = parse_config(
}[args.verb](args, last)
if last.tools_tree and last.tools_tree == Path("default"):
- tools = finalize_default_tools(args, last, resources=resources)
+ tools = finalize_default_tools(last, resources=resources)
else:
tools = None